What it is
The big superficial muscle of the chest, fanning from the breastbone and collarbone to a surprisingly small tendon on the front of the humerus.
It has two heads with different origins and, importantly, different lines of pull:
- Clavicular head — from the inner half of the collarbone, running downward and outward
- Sternocostal head — from the sternum and the cartilages of the upper ribs, running upward and outward
Its tendon twists as it approaches the humerus, so fibres from the bottom of the sternal head attach highest.
Because the two heads pull from above and below the joint, they oppose each other in the vertical plane while cooperating in adduction. The clavicular head flexes the shoulder; the sternocostal head extends it from a flexed position.
What it does
Adducts the arm — pulls it across and towards the body — and internally rotates it. It is the prime mover of anything hugging, pressing or throwing across the body.
The clavicular head assists shoulder flexion, raising the arm forward. The sternocostal head pulls the raised arm back down.
With the arms fixed above you, it can pull the trunk upward, which is part of climbing.
What loads it
Pressing away from the body, and adduction against resistance: push-ups, bench pressing, dips and flyes.
The push-up is the main one, with the incline push-up as the scaled version — the height of the hands sets the load.
What is commonly got wrong about it
"Upper chest" and "lower chest" as separate muscles. They are two heads of one muscle with genuinely different lines of pull, so incline and decline angles do shift emphasis — this is one of the better-supported regional claims in training. What is oversold is the precision: the notion that specific degrees of incline target specific bands is far beyond what anyone has demonstrated.
"Inner chest" exercises. There is no inner pectoral muscle. The definition down the middle of the chest is where the muscle attaches to the sternum, plus the fat over it.
That pec size prevents shoulder problems, or causes them. Claims in both directions are common and neither is well supported.
